Output 43ff52aa143ee3f3d8f5399e15ec58b21c31de1464219f0d86844a347589b71d:5

value
12000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eab7b9b2ddd56bfebb016df7bfc8a9c6592a0f08 OP_EQUAL
address
3P668tuEFPV52U6XH9aP3yB4tNVCCvTMJX
transaction
43ff52aa143ee3f3d8f5399e15ec58b21c31de1464219f0d86844a347589b71d
spent
true